Wright County resident Katrina Frank and her family mourn their dog Jakey. Frank claims that Jakee was injured during his Amazon delivery at his home last month.
According to Frank, Jakey (Rottweiler) and the family’s other dog were outside their home near Buffalo on Oct. 16 when an unexpected Amazon delivery arrived.
In a Facebook post, Frank said the dogs came to say hello and a woman got out of the passenger seat of the car and started screaming, prompting the male driver to get out of the car.

Over the next few days, Frank shared an update on Jakey’s deteriorating condition on Facebook.
“Last night Jake was very quiet and withdrawn, refusing to eat or go out at all,” Frank wrote on Oct. 18.
On Wednesday, Frank shared that Jakey was subdued after continuing to show signs of health problems, including sporadic eating, dizzy-like episodes, and feeling lethargic and depressed.

A veterinarian determined that Jakey was suffering from a ruptured lump in his liver.

An Amazon spokeswoman said the delivery was made by a woman who works as a contractor for Amazon Flex. Her husband intervened.
A spokesperson said, “We are deeply saddened to hear of Jakey’s passing and have continued to work with the family to support them since this was first reported.”
Amazon confirmed that the woman is still delivering to the company.
